Vertex Resource Group Ltd. is seeking a Wildlife Technician/Biologist to conduct field surveys for wildlife and sensitive species and to prepare regulatory reports for upstream oil and gas facilities and associated disturbances.
The role requires strong bird identification, data collection, and the ability to work in Western Canada. Reporting to the Team Lead, the successful candidate will coordinate field studies, mentor junior staff, and communicate with clients during construction activities.

Vertex is currently accepting applications for a full-time permanent position as a Wildlife Technician/Biologist. The successful candidate must have experience coordinating and participating in field-based projects, for the purpose of collecting, analyzing, and reporting on biophysical data. Reporting to our Team Lead, the Wildlife Technician/Biologist must be someone that has strong wildlife identification skills with emphasis on bird identification and habitat assessment experience. Additional experience in other environmental service lines (e.g., contaminated sites, soil assessments, construction monitoring, wetlands, forestry) will have a competitive advantage.
